HINDENBURG ZEPPELIN TICKET MENU CERTIFICATE NAMED GROUPING
A great group of five original items given to Julius Heinrich Arp for his July 25, 1936 flight from Rio De Janeiro to Frankfurt on board the famed airship ‘Hindenburg'. Includes: the original printed ticket numbered 393, issued to Arp for the 96-hour flight; a specially-printed brochure for the flight, 4.75 x 8 in., titled ‘Dedicated to our Passengers' and containing much detailed information about the airship including a list of guests, crew members and their roles, specs for the airship, navigation route, and so forth; an original sheet of official ‘Hindenburg' air mail stationery; a menu for lunch and supper on Saturday, July 25, 1936, with offerings such as ‘Wiener schnitzel', ‘perch filet Gypsy style' and ‘Tournedos [beef] Helder with green beans and potatoes'; and a somewhat eerie, 1p. partly-printed personalized engraving, 7.5 x 9.5 in., showing ‘Aeolus…the son of Hippotes, a friend of the immortal gods and rightful ruler of the winds…' bestowing a favorable flight on Arp and the airship. This etching perfectly captures the Nazi obsession with Greek mythology that permeates so much of its iconography. Expected foxing and light toning, overall very good condition. Five pieces.
